S2008 Posted June 9, 2014 Share Posted June 9, 2014 To set the scene I'm in 2017 with Wehen Wiesbaden- fortunately we've had a good run over the past few years and find ourselves in the Bundesliga. The stadium was limited to 12,000 so I bought it from the company I was renting it from and expanded it to 16,000 which appears to be the maximum capacity. I've heard that it takes 20 years or so between building stadiums. The stadium itself was constructed in 2007 but we bought it in 2017- when will the game consider allowing me to construct a new stadium 2027 or 2037? Rikulec Posted June 9, 2014 Share Posted June 9, 2014 The stadium was built in 2007, so you'll be able to request a new one in 2027 at the earliest. Buying it in 2017 doesn't matter here.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
eple Posted June 10, 2014 Share Posted June 10, 2014 Don't get your hopes up though. It might not be accepted immediately and then you have to go through the planning and construction phase. With a stadium built in 2006 I had to wait until 2035 to move into a new one.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
